Website security is more important than ever as businesses face increasing risks from data breaches, malware, phishing attacks, and unauthorized access. In 2026, secure website development should be a priority from the very beginning of every web project.
1. Use HTTPS and SSL Certificates
Every business website should use HTTPS to encrypt information exchanged between users and the server. An active SSL certificate also helps build visitor trust and is an important part of modern website security.
2. Keep Software and Plugins Updated
Outdated CMS platforms, themes, plugins, libraries, and frameworks can create security vulnerabilities. Developers should regularly apply security patches and remove unnecessary plugins or components.
3. Implement Strong Authentication
Use strong passwords, secure login systems, multi-factor authentication, and appropriate access controls. Administrative accounts should have only the permissions they actually need.
4. Protect Forms and User Data
Website forms should be protected against common attacks such as SQL injection, cross-site scripting (XSS), and malicious input. Sensitive customer information should be collected, processed, and stored securely.
5. Perform Regular Security Testing
Security testing should be part of ongoing website maintenance. Vulnerability scans, code reviews, penetration testing, and monitoring can help identify potential weaknesses before attackers exploit them.
6. Maintain Secure Backups
Regular, encrypted backups provide an additional layer of protection. If a website is compromised, reliable backups can help businesses restore their website and minimize downtime.
